Based on recent listing data, rent for a studio at 7100 S JEFFERY BLVD, Chicago, IL ranges from $1,054 to $1,426 per month, with a median of $1,240.
Based on recent listing data, rent for a 1-bedroom at 7100 S JEFFERY BLVD, Chicago, IL ranges from $1,131 to $1,529 per month, with a median of $1,330.
Based on recent listing data, rent for a 2-bedroom at 7100 S JEFFERY BLVD, Chicago, IL ranges from $1,275 to $1,725 per month, with a median of $1,500.
Based on recent listing data, rent for a 3-bedroom at 7100 S JEFFERY BLVD, Chicago, IL ranges from $1,641 to $2,220 per month, with a median of $1,930.
Based on recent listing data, rent for a 4-bedroom at 7100 S JEFFERY BLVD, Chicago, IL ranges from $1,921 to $2,599 per month, with a median of $2,260.
Based on available records, 7100 S JEFFERY BLVD, Chicago, IL is not currently registered as rent stabilized. Rents at this building are likely set at market rate.
